What are the height and placement rules for a fence on my Jasmine Estates property?
Zoning is 4 feet maximum in the front yard and 6 feet in the rear, with a zero-foot setback allowed on the property line. Corner lots have critical visibility 'sight triangles' that must remain clear. Fences near the US-19 corridor require strict adherence to these sight lines for driver safety.
What fencing materials are suitable for Jasmine Estates' soil and termite risk?
Soil has a moderate corrosivity index. Use hot-dip galvanized or powder-coated steel posts and brackets. Termite risk is very heavy. Avoid wood posts in direct ground contact. Use concrete-filled steel posts or composite materials. Stainless steel fasteners prevent rust streaks on finishes.
What is required before digging fence post holes in my yard?
State law requires contacting Sunshine 811 at least two full business days before excavation. Hitting a utility line in Jasmine Estates causes major liability, service outages, and repair costs. We manage the 811 ticket and coordinate any required city permit office paperwork for the installation.
Why are concrete footings required for a fence in Jasmine Estates with no frost?
Florida's zero-inch frost line is irrelevant. Footings provide resistance against V-ult 150 MPH wind uplift and overturning forces. Per IRC, posts in Jasmine Estates Central fail from wind shear without a concrete anchor. We design footings for soil-bearing capacity and lateral stability.

What are my legal duties to a neighbor when replacing a fence in Jasmine Estates?
Florida Statute 588.011 governs livestock fencing, but common civil law on partition fences applies. In 2026, best practice requires notifying adjoining property owners in writing before altering a shared boundary. This prevents disputes over maintenance responsibility and establishes a paper trail for any future claims.
How does the 150 MPH wind rating affect my fence design?
The V-ult 150 MPH wind speed is an ultimate design load per ASCE 7-22 standards. It dictates post spacing, concrete footing size, and bracket strength. A fence in Jasmine Estates Central must withstand peak storm season gusts. Standard 8-foot panel spacing often fails; we calculate spacing based on specific exposure.
How do smart gates integrate with Florida pool safety codes?
Florida Building Code Residential Section R4501.17 mandates specific latch heights and self-closing mechanisms for pool barriers. Modern IoT gate systems can integrate compliant hardware, providing automated locking and access logs. This meets the 2026 standard for monitored security and reduces liability for homeowners.
